## Deploying the Gatewick Proctor Queue

Deploys are pretty painless: push to main, wait for the pipeline, then watch the queue drain dashboard for five minutes. If candidates pile up mid-exam, roll back first and ask questions later — the queue replays safely. Everything the workers care about lives in one config block, shown here for reference.

settings of bafof-yagef:
JOROX_PIN=8740
JOROX_TENANT=pelox
JOROX_METRICS_HOST=metrics.jorox.qorvelworks.internal
JOROX_SEAL=seal_c78f63c1
JOROX_STANDBY_TEAM=norax

Handover: Corvid broker upgrade (from Tessa to whoever picks this up)

We're mid-upgrade from Corvid 3.x to 4.1 across the Fenwold cluster. Nodes 1–4 are done; 5 and 6 are pending the maintenance window. Do NOT enable the new compaction flag until all nodes are upgraded — mixed versions corrupt the offset index. Consumers on the billing topic need the client library bumped first. Rollback snapshot is retained for 14 days. Checklist, node order, and verification queries are all on the upgrade page.

runbook for badug-kadup: https://confluence.zemvarlabs.internal/projects/browse/display/projects/bd1b

## Parcelbeam Webhook: Limits and Quotas

For this week's sync: the Parcelbeam parcel-tracking webhook enforces per-endpoint delivery quotas to protect downstream consumers. Deliveries beyond the burst window are queued, then dropped after the retention cutoff. Retries use exponential backoff with jitter, and misbehaving endpoints get suspended automatically. The enforcement thresholds are compiled in and shown below for reference.

constants for bawif-kawif:
QUOTAS = {
    "ulaael": 5,
    "holael": 10,
}